Furthermore, both are hunters that use the bow; both are the first men who were inducted into the clan of different species (dwarven clan Drgrimst Ingeitum in Eragon's case, na'vi clan Omaticaya in Jake's) by a clan leader who later was murdered by hostile human forces from the air (Hrothgar / Eytukan); both fall in love with a raven-haired princess from a forest folk (elf Arya in Eragon's case, na'vi Neytiri in Jake's), who is also a wise and formidable warrior and Rider of a green dragonish beast; both were trapped and jailed by evil humans, but later rescued by their friends; both have to fight against his former ally (Murtagh in Eragon's case, colonel Quaritch in Jake's); both talk with an ancient tree with magic-like powers (Menoa Tree / Tree of Souls) to get a help and both had injuries of their back in human form before the ceremony of their final transformation into a hybrid under that tree. While the rumor most likely didn't have a real bearing on Paolini's plotting, it is still notable in how Murtagh and Eragon (The characters often compared to Han and Luke in the original book respectively) starting in Eldest are put into a strikingly similar situation where the former is captured and through mystical means forced into the service of their stories' respective ruling Empires with his then best friend (the main protagonist) having to face them as enemies.
